Karel Armstrong is offering a colored pencil class in the MAG downstairs art studio. It is a four weeks class and will meet on March 9, 16, 23, and 30 in the afternoon from 1 pm to 4 pm.
The title of the class is COLORED PENCIL AS YOU LIKE IT. The class will benefit the beginner as well as the novice and intermediate artist. All work will be from your own ideas and or photos. No computer borrowed photos.
Beginners will learn the techniques of blending, layering, and color families. Mixed media with the colored pencil will be explored and discussed along with the use of a watercolor base and Washi, Thai and Japanese rice, fiber and lace papers.

Oil Painting Classes with Sheila Savannah
Improving Your Oil Painting Skills - 6 wk. class
Tuesday afternoons January 17 - Feb. 21st. 1:00-4:00 p.m.
LOCATION - MOUNTAIN ARTIST'S GUILD - LOWER LEVEL - 228 N. ALARCON
COST- $150.00 (6 weeks)
Demos, critiques, one-on-one time designed to help you move forward with your skills. Emphasizing fundamentals, color mixing, palette knife, and edges.
